llgd.net
当前位置:首页 >> 脚本 iF ElsE >>

脚本 iF ElsE

::══代══码══开══始═══ @echo off title 窗口模式设置 color 1c set/p mode=是否选用最大窗口模式(Y/N)?: if /i %mode%==Y (goto max) else goto min :max start /max set.bat exit :min start set.bat exit ::══代══码══结══束═══ ::加上括号...

@echo off set /p notifyType=“输入1,否则错误” if "%notifyType%"=="1" ( 括号前面至少要有一个空格 echo ok ) else ( else要和if前面的结束括号)和自身的括号(在同一行 echo no )

不必须,可以直接 if 【条件】 【要做的内容】 fi; 这样就可以了。也可以用else if 【条件1】 【要做的内容1】 else if 【条件2】 【要做的内容2】 fi;

首先应该是0不是o $?是shell变量,表示"最后一次执行命令"的退出状态.0为成功,非0为失败. 在你的问题里就是,if语句前一个命令执行成功,就怎么样

楼主啊,我运行了你给的脚本,结果没问题哦。 我回答一下你追问的问题: 1) If这种语句有两种模式,一种是单行的If,另一种是多行的If。 单行的If可以写成: If a = 2 Then MsgBox "你是猪" 不用加End If 但是多行的If需要End If 比如我这样写:...

if 条件;then if 条件;then 代码 else 代码 fi else if 条件;then 代码 else 代码 fi fi

$# 取得shell脚本参数个数, -lt 即 less than,小于, $0 取得脚本名称(包含路径) 若判断参数个数小于7个,则用echo打印正确的使用方法,并用exit退出脚本。 Usage: 脚本名称 subject analysis_dir anat_name anat_dir_name sanlm_denoised n...

awk ' { if ($1==1) print "A" else if ($1==2) print "B" else print "C" }' #命名为1.sh 执行方法:echo "1" | sh 1.sh 写成一行: echo "3" | awk '{if ($1==1) print "A"; else if ($1==2) print "B"; else print "C"}'

@echo off :start set /p first="请选择,输入1运行1号程序,输入2运行2号程序:" if %first% LEQ 2 ( goto first ) else ( echo 输入错误!请重新输入! goto start ) :first IF %first% == 1 goto one ELSE goto two exit :one rem 这里是你要执行...

c语言字符串不能直接比较 得用strcmp函数 ----- strcmp C/C++函数,比较两个字符串 设这两个字符串为str1,str2, 若str1=str2,则返回零; 若str1str2,则返回正数。

网站首页 | 网站地图
All rights reserved Powered by www.llgd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com